Sc₁Ga₂Ru₁ is an intermetallic compound combining scandium, gallium, and ruthenium in a defined stoichiometric ratio. This is a research-phase material rather than an established commercial alloy; it belongs to the family of ternary intermetallics that are investigated for their electronic and structural properties at the intersection of transition metals and p-block elements. Interest in such compounds typically centers on potential applications in thermoelectrics, quantum materials, or high-performance aerospace alloys, though industrial deployment remains limited pending further characterization and scalability studies.
